AFCL: Analytic Federated Continual Learning for Spatio-Temporal Invariance of Non-IID Data
AFCL solves federated continual learning without gradients by aggregating local Gram matrices and label statistics, proving exact spatio-temporal invariance: the global model equals centralized joint learning for any data partition.
